Educated Appointments are delighted to be supporting an Ofsted rated 'GOOD' college, who have an exciting opportunity for an Assessor/Trainer - Building Services/Heating & Ventilation to join the Construction team. You will join us on a full-time time basis and in return you will receive a competitive salary plus generous staff benefits package. Our client boasts specialist vocational facilities in a range of areas from engineering, construction, science to catering, hospitality and hair and beauty. Main Purpose Based at our Cambridge Campus, you will be responsible for a caseload of apprentices, where you will coordinate and track the development of their knowledge, skills and behaviours throughout their apprenticeship programmes. Working closely with the teaching delivery team, you will monitor individual apprentice progress and provide feedback to employers during regular learning review meetings. You will be responsible for setting and monitoring individual apprentice targets and providing developmental support throughout the apprenticeship. You will ensure apprentices complete all learning activities leading to their successful completion of their programmes, providing training and mentoring in order for them to successfully complete End Point Assessment. Responsibilities Take overall responsibility for an agreed caseload of learners to provide high quality training, coaching, mentoring, instruction and assessment to learners to achieve their apprenticeship and/or qualification in a timely manner. Act as main point of contact for employers and learners, creating positive relationships with employers to support in the training and development of learners and, providing feedback on progress as required. Organising and provide training and support for students. Conducting assessments. Conducting reviews and completing records. End Point Assessment preparation and training. Administrative responsibilities. Health and Safety responsibilities. Maintaining and updating your knowledge and skills (CPD). Regularly communicating with employers to build and maintain good relationships. Business development. Undertaking such other duties as may be required commensurate with the grade. Agile working This role allows for a degree of agile working. You will be required to visit apprentices in their workplace and assist with their development while attending college. Administrative duties can be carried out by working from home. What we are looking for in our role: Qualified to Level 3 in a Building Services/Heating and Ventilation related discipline. A wide range of relevant industry experience. Assessing and IQA qualifications are desirable, but training will be available for suitable candidates. Previous experience of training, coaching, mentoring or assessing is desirable; withing an educational or industry setting. Knowledge of current Apprenticeship Standards and End Point Assessment requirements is desirable, but training in this area will be given to suitable candidates. Good planning, interpersonal and communication skills. Confident using a range of IT systems. Ability to work flexibly, and in possession of current driving licence, and be willing to use own car, insured for business use (mileage will be reimbursed), or alternative means to travel extensively. A team player and maintains a professional approach all the time.
